The invention provides a traction frame buffer mechanism which comprises a lock hook, a connecting frame and a traction frame, the lock hook and the connecting frame are hinged through a main pin, the connecting frame comprises a lug plate hinged to the lock hook and a first limiting plate, a guide shaft penetrates through the first limiting plate and the traction frame, and the guide shaft and the first limiting plate are fixed into a whole. A limiting assembly installed on the outer side of the traction frame is arranged at the end, away from the connecting frame, of the guiding shaft, the guiding shaft is sleeved with a buffering assembly arranged in the traction frame, and the two ends of the buffering assembly penetrate through the traction frame and extend outwards to make contact with the first limiting plate and the limiting assembly. The device has the beneficial effects that the buffering assembly arranged on the outer side of the guide shaft in a sleeving mode is used for buffering, and axial movement of the guide shaft is effectively limited through the first limiting plate on the connecting frame and the limiting assembly arranged at the other end of the guide shaft when the buffering assembly is used for buffering; the phenomenon that the guide shaft is dislocated due to the fact that traction force/traction resistance is too large when the mechanism is started or stopped or under complex road conditions is avoided.
